Do smart gates meet Pennsylvania pool fence codes?

Yes, when properly integrated. The IBC/IRC Appendix AG requires pool barriers to have self-closing, self-latching gates with latches at least 48 inches high. Modern Wi-Fi access control systems can integrate certified mechanical latches that meet this standard, providing both smart access and compliance for liability protection.

Why do fence posts in Downtown Williams need deep concrete footings?

Williams has a 40-inch frost line. Footings shallower than this depth will lift due to frost heave, cracking posts and rails. Per IRC Section R403.1.4, all structural footings must extend a minimum of 12 inches below undisturbed earth and below the frost line. Posts here must be set in concrete at least 44 inches deep to ensure stability.

How does the local wind rating affect fence construction?

Williams has a V-ult wind speed of 115 MPH. This engineering rating, per ASCE 7-22, dictates post spacing, concrete footing size, and bracket strength. A standard 6-foot privacy fence here typically requires 4x4 posts set 8 feet on-center or less, with reinforced corner posts, to survive peak storm season gusts without panel failure.

What is required before digging fence post holes in Downtown Williams?

You must contact Pennsylvania 811 at least three business days before excavation. They mark all public utility lines. Hitting an unmarked line in a dense neighborhood like Downtown creates major liability and service disruptions. The fencing contractor typically manages the 811 process and pulls any required permit from the Williams Municipal Building permit office.
